WebApr 21, 2024 · The following are 15 best Cantonese foods you must try. 1. Ah Yat Abalone. Chinese Name: 阿一鲍鱼 ā yī bào yú. Flavor: fresh, tender. Cooking Method: braise, simmer. It is one of the best Cantonese dishes created by Yang Guanyi who is considered the “king of abalone”. WebApr 10, 2024 · Wanton Mee. Wanton mee, also known as wonton noodles, is an authentic Malaysian dish of Cantonese origin. A must-try, wanton mee is made using egg noodles and a rich yet light broth. The dish is not only popular in Penang but also in other parts of Asia.
